The Collect of the Mass tells us with what dispositions<br />

we should pray. We must acknowledge that God is<br />

the source of all grace ; beg of Him to pour out upon<br />

us His loving kindness with the firm conviction that He<br />

will hear our prayer in a measure far beyond our merits.<br />

The Secret urges us to render to God the homage of<br />

our submission, imploring of Him that He would deign<br />

to accept it, and to come to the heljp of our weak<br />

ness. The Postoiommunion would have us look upon<br />

the participation in the divine mysteries as the remedy<br />

for the evils of both soul and body.<br />

The teachings of the Mass for this Sunday may be<br />

APPLIED TO THE RELIGIOUS LIFE. The SOUls that Wish<br />

to embrace the religious life, must, like the deaf and<br />

dumb man in the Gospel, retire from the world ; fol<br />

low Jesus Christ ; open their ears to His call, and conse<br />

crate their lips to the divine praises. Fidelity to<br />

their vocation and final perseverance depend in great<br />

measure on prayer, the frequentation of the Sacra<br />

ments, amendment of life and the constant practice of<br />

virtue.
